Back to school part 1

This week the summer holidays are coming to an end.

It has made me mostly feel emotional, somehow sad that my big girl will be going to school again and that she won’t be free to be home for five days in a row, every week for almost a whole year.
But after today things have changed a little bit.
My three year old is starting pre –school this school year and that’s something that I’m really excited about. I’m so proud that my little girl will be going to ( pre-)school for the first time.

She had been offered a place in two different play schools and she was supposed to start next week on Monday in one of them but today I decided to put her on the other play school which started their school year yesterday.

I started a course in child care last year and from September I will have to do work experience and it suited better if I put her on the school I've chosen now.

And since big sister is starting school this Thursday and the play school is in the same building and starts at the same time, I thought it would be nice for her to start this Thursday as well instead of tomorrow already .

This will also give me some time to get some last things sorted.
So today I went and got my three year old a lunch bag since she will have to bring her own lunch in this play school.(in the other play school they were providing a snack) She saw the Hello Kitty lunch bag in the shop and wanted it straight away. When I handed it over to her on her request she put it straight away in the shopping trolley. So cute! Later she held it in her hand but she gave it back so we could pay for it at the counter. Her toy phone apparently ended up in it as we noticed when the cashier wanted to scan it. My little girl is really growing up.

For my big girl Ix, I already had been shopping: new uniforms, stockings, shoes, vests and books. Tomorrow I have to get a few last things for both girls and then they will be ready for school on Thursday.
But since they are now starting on the same day, I no longer feel sad about Ix starting school again. Because the same day will be a big milestone for Yov and that makes me so excited, I can’t be sad at the same time.

I also went and got some info about another crèche where we potentially will put Nevaeh in the future.
It’s also not too far from where we live and apart from the price it seems to suit us well.

So I really feel blessed today. I also finally found a place to do work experience for the child care course. God is good, merciful and faithful. Glory to His name!
